Talent.com
This job offer is not available in your country.
Software Developer - Senior

Software Developer - Senior

HalliburtonBengaluru, Karnataka, India
7 hours ago
Job description

We are looking for the right people — people who want to innovate, achieve, grow and lead. We attract and retain the best talent by investing in our employees and empowering them to develop themselves and their careers. Experience the challenges, rewards and opportunity of working for one of the world’s largest providers of products and services to the global energy industry.

Job Duties

The successful candidate will work on innovative technologies as an integral member of the Information Management and Platform Technologies Development team within Halliburton’s Landmark Software & Services Product Service Line. The candidate will have the opportunity to work on the latest software technologies in the industry, apply their innovative ideas and create the next generation software products.

Key Responsibilities / Accountabilities :

  • Design, develop, and maintain enterprise-grade applications using Java and J2EE technologies.
  • Build and deploy RESTful and SOAP-based web services.
  • Architect and implement microservices using frameworks like Quarkus.
  • Work with relational and NoSQL databases including Oracle, SQL Server, PostgreSQL, and MongoDB.
  • Write efficient SQL queries and perform advanced data manipulation, analysis, and reporting.
  • Develop and maintain shell scripts for automation across Linux and Windows environments.
  • Containerize applications using Docker and orchestrate deployments with Kubernetes.
  • Configure and manage build pipelines using Maven and Git-based CI / CD tools.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Ensure code quality through unit testing, code reviews, and adherence to best practices.

Qualifications & Experience

Required Skills and Qualifications :

  • Bachelor’s degree in Computer Science or related fields
  • 6–10 years of professional experience in Java development.
  • Strong proficiency in J2EE, including Servlets, JSP, EJB, and JMS.
  • Experience with Quarkus or similar microservices frameworks (e.g., Spring Boot).
  • Advanced SQL skills, including query optimization, joins, indexing, and stored procedures.
  • Solid understanding of database design and performance tuning across Oracle, SQL Server, PostgreSQL, and NoSQL DBs.
  • Proficiency in Linux and Windows environments, including shell scripting.
  • Hands-on experience with Docker and Kubernetes for container orchestration.
  • Familiarity with Maven for build automation and Git-based CI / CD workflows.
  • Experience with cloud platforms such as AWS, Azure, or Google Cloud.
  • Familiarity with Helm charts for Kubernetes application packaging and deployment.
  • Experience integrating OAuth tools for secure authentication and authorization
  • Ability to work independently as a strong individual contributor and mentor junior team members.
  • Proven ability to troubleshoot performance issues across application, database, and infrastructure layers.
  • Strong problem-solving skills and a passion for clean, maintainable code.
  • Desired Skills and Qualifications :

  • Master’s degree in Computer Science, Information Technology, or equivalent field is preferrable
  • Experience with Apache Kafka for distributed messaging and event-driven architecture.
  • Exposure to the Oil & Gas Upstream domain, including drilling and subsurface workflows.
  • Knowledge of API gateways, service mesh, and observability tools.
  • Familiarity with Agile / Scrum methodologies.
  • Understanding of Machine Learning, Generative AI, and Agentic AI technologies.
  • Characteristics : Proven technical abilities; strong communication, analytical and decision-making skills; 8+ years of experience.

    Halliburton is an Equal Opportunity Employer. Employment decisions are made without regard to race, color, religion, disability, genetic information, pregnancy, citizenship, marital status, sex / gender, sexual preference / orientation, gender identity, age, veteran status, national origin, or any other status protected by law or regulation .

    Location

    4th Floor, Gardenia 2D, Bengaluru, ,  ,

    Job Details

    Requisition Number :

    Experience Level :   Experienced Hire

    Job Family :  Engineering / Science / Technology

    Product Service Line :   Landmark Software & Services

    Full Time / Part Time :   Full Time

    Additional Locations for this position :

    Compensation Information

    Compensation is competitive and commensurate with experience.

    Create a job alert for this search

    Senior Software Developer • Bengaluru, Karnataka, India

    Related jobs
    • Promoted
    • New!
    Senior Software Engineer

    Senior Software Engineer

    OutSystemsBangalore, Karnataka, India
    There are NO limits to your career : come shape the future and be part of a truly unique global culture at OutSystems!.The team is building our cloud-native data pipeline that ingests massive amount...Show moreLast updated: 7 hours ago
    • Promoted
    Senior Backend Developer

    Senior Backend Developer

    Stealthhosur, tamil nadu, in
    Fintech Unicorn seeking backend engineers who love building systems that millions trust with their money.Your code directly affects millions of users' financial lives - from seamless payments to sm...Show moreLast updated: 7 days ago
    • Promoted
    • New!
    Senior Software Developer

    Senior Software Developer

    ExxonMobilBengaluru, Karnataka, India
    At ExxonMobil, our vision is to lead in energy innovations that advance modern living and a net-zero future.As one of the world’s largest publicly traded energy and chemical companies, we are power...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    SENIOR SOFTWARE DEVELOPER

    SENIOR SOFTWARE DEVELOPER

    The Nielsen CompanyBengaluru, Karnataka, India
    At Nielsen, we believe that career growth is a partnership.You ultimately own, fuel and set the journey.By joining our team of nearly 14,000 associates, you will become part of a community that wil...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Backend Developer

    Senior Backend Developer

    TransakBengaluru, Karnataka, India
    Transak is a leading Web3 payments infrastructure provider used by top partners like Metamask, Trust Wallet, Ledger, Coinbase with 10M+ registered users. Its API & widget driven solutions enable web...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Developer

    Senior Developer

    HARMAN InternationalBommasandra, Karnataka, India
    HARMAN’s engineers and designers are creative, purposeful and agile.As part of this team, you’ll combine your technical expertise with innovative ideas to help drive cutting-edge solutions in the c...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Principal Software Developer

    Senior Principal Software Developer

    Raytheon TechnologiesYelahanka, Karnataka, India
    We're seeking a highly skilled DevSecOps Engineer to help us build reliable, scalable systems that elevate the user DevSecOps experience. In this role, you'll be responsible for developing key DevSe...Show moreLast updated: 7 hours ago
    • Promoted
    Senior Software Engineer

    Senior Software Engineer

    ObliviousBengaluru, Karnataka, India
    We live in the era of data and AI, but the most impactful data resides behind closed doors and red tape.Using it, which many do, risks undermining the privacy and confidentiality of users, customer...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Software Developer (Mid to Senior)

    Software Developer (Mid to Senior)

    Crypto.comBengaluru, Karnataka, India
    We are a team to design, develop, maintain, and improve software for various ventures projects, , projects that are adjacent to our core businesses and are bootstrapped fast with a lean team.You wi...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Software Developer

    Senior Software Developer

    Prudential plcBengaluru, Karnataka, India
    We are seeking a talented Software Developer with extensive experience in Node.TypeScript, and API development.The ideal candidate will have a proven track record of building robust RESTful APIs, G...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Software Engineer, Developer Platform

    Senior Software Engineer, Developer Platform

    RokuBengaluru, Karnataka, India
    Teamwork makes the stream work.Roku is changing how the world watches TV.Roku is the #1 TV streaming platform in the U.Canada, and Mexico, and we've set our sights on powering every television in t...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Software Developer

    Senior Software Developer

    OracleBengaluru, Karnataka, India
    As part of the Oracle Analytics Platform division, you will contribute to software design, development, and debugging.Assisting in the definition and development of software solutions that are scal...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ior, Software Developer M2C

    Senior, Software Developer M2C

    Schneider ElectricBengaluru, Karnataka, India
    We are a global Digital transformation team in Schneider Electric mainly focusing on Smart Factory solution and Analytics development for ETO LoB. We are looking for some talented and experienced Ou...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Software Developer

    Senior Software Developer

    Intertec Softwares Pvt LtdBengaluru, Karnataka, India
    Senior Software Developer React.Engineering / Frontend Development.RESPONSIBILITIES (INCLUDES ALL TASKS) : .We are seeking a highly skilled and experienced React. Technical Lead to drive the design a...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Software Engineer

    Senior Software Engineer

    Index ExchangeBengaluru, Karnataka, India
    At Index Exchange, we’re reinventing how digital advertising works—at scale.As a global advertising supply-side platform, we empower the world’s leading media owners and marketers to thrive in a pr...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Software Engineer

    Senior Software Engineer

    VyaparBengaluru, Karnataka, India
    We are a technology and innovation company in the fintech space, delivering business accounting software to Micro, Small & Medium Enterprises (MSMEs). With more than 10 Million users across 140 coun...Show moreLast updated: 7 hours ago
    • Promoted
    • New!
    Senior Full-Stack Developer

    Senior Full-Stack Developer

    Volvo CarsNandhagudi, Karnataka, India
    We bring bold digital visions to life.So we’re on the lookout for more curious and creative engineers who want to create change – one line of high-quality code at a time. Our transformation isn't fo...Show moreLast updated: 3 hours ago
    • Promoted
    Senior LogicMonitor Developer

    Senior LogicMonitor Developer

    iVedha Inc.Bengaluru, IN
    Job Title : Senior LogicMonitor Developer.Platform Engineering Practice is looking for a.API-based integration and automation. In this role, you will lead the design and implementation of monitoring ...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    Senior Developer

    Senior Developer

    EpsilonBengaluru, Karnataka, India
    Platform Services specializes in the implementation, management and evolution of Custom and PeopleCloud solutions, offering end-to-end support for clients. Our team of experts handles platform setup...Show moreLast updated: 3 hours ago
    • Promoted
    • New!
    Senior Developer - webMethods

    Senior Developer - webMethods

    Manhattan AssociatesBengaluru, Karnataka, India
    We create possibilities that move life and commerce forward.Every day, our supply chain commerce technology connects two billion people to 20 billion consumer choices. In the warehouse, on the road ...Show moreLast updated: 7 hours ago